I took our student loans to attend a college in one state...now I live in another state and don't work so I file married filing jointly on my income taxes under my husband's income...can they take my state taxes under these circumstances, as well as my federal?

Oh yeah. If these are federal loans, they can seize any federal repayment due to you.....it doesnt matter what state you live in.

Your husband may qualify for Injured Spouse Relief http://www.irs.gov/pub/irs-pdf/f8379.pdf to get all or a portion of the offset back. If all of the income is his, and it can be proven.
If you live in a community property state, you might not be granted any relief!
